The Virginia Museum of Fine Arts (VMFA) located in Richmond, Virginia, is one of the largest comprehensive art museums in the United States, known for its encyclopedic collection of over 50,000 works of art spanning 6,000 years of world history. VMFA’s collection includes the largest public collection of Faberg outside Russia, the finest Art Nouveau collection outside Paris, and one of the nation finest American art collections. The museum also boasts notable collections in Chinese art, English silver, French Impressionism, Postimpressionism, British sporting art, modern and contemporary art, as well as acclaimed South Asian, Himalayan, and African art pieces. Recognized as the 11th-best art museum in the United States by The Washington Post, VMFA is unique in being the only US art museum open 365 days a year with free general admission. As a state-supported and privately endowed educational institution, its mission is to collect, preserve, exhibit, interpret art, encourage arts study, and enrich the community's cultural life.
Within the museum, the Food Services Department offers distinct dining experiences to visitors. Floris, situated in the Pauley Center Parlor, is a culinary venue that embraces global tea culture traditions offering inclusive and unique experiences. The seasonal rotating menu is inspired by tea-centric regions worldwide and highlights teas from minority and women-owned Virginia-based vendors. Every element of a meal at Floris is thoughtfully designed to create the right atmosphere, evoke feelings, and deliver an exceptional dining energy. The team at Floris is composed of dedicated service professionals committed to exceptional guest experiences while supporting the museum's mission.
